On a piano, a key has a frequency, say f0. Each higher key (black or white) has a frequency of f0 * rn, where n is the distance
lesantik [10]

Answer:

In C:

#include <stdio.h>

#include <math.h>

int main(){

   float f0,r,temp;

   r = pow(2.0,1.0/12);

   printf("f0: ");    scanf("%f", &f0);

   temp = f0;

   for(int i = 0; i<=4;i++){

       f0 = f0 * pow(r,i);

       printf("%.2lf ", f0);

       f0 = temp;    }

   return 0;

}

Explanation:

This declares f0, r and temp as float

   float f0,r,temp;

This initializes r to 2^(1/12)

   r = pow(2.0,1.0/12);

This prompts the user for f0

   printf("f0: ");    scanf("%f", &f0);

This saves f0 in temp

   temp = f0;

This iterates the number of keys from 0 to 4

   for(int i = 0; i<=4;i++){

This calculates each key

       f0 = f0 * pow(r,i);

This prints the key

       printf("%.2lf ", f0);

This gets the initial value of f0

       f0 = temp;    }

   return 0;
